A 12- foot ladder that is leaning against a wall makes a 75.5 degree angle with the level ground

Step-by-step explanation:

When the ladder leans against the wall, it forms a right angle triangle with the wall. The length of the ladder becomes the hypotenuse of the right angle triangle.

Since the length of the ladder is 12 foot, then

Hypotenuse = 12 foot

The angle formed by the ladder with the ground is 75.5 degrees. Therefore, the height, y which is the distance from the point where the ladder touches the wall to the foot of the wall becomes the opposite side. It would be determined by applying trigonometric ratio

Sin θ = opposite side/hypotenuse

Sin 75.5 = y/12

Mary sews at a rate of 60 inches per hour. How many feet does she sew in a minute?
makvit [3.9K]

Answer:

B. 0.083 rounded to the nearest thousandth.

Step-by-step explanation:

It is known that 12 inches = 1 foot and

60 minutes = 1 hour

Since we want to covert from inches per hour to feet per minute, then we would change 60 inches to feet in 1 hour 2 minutes in divide.

If 12 inches = 1 foot, then

60 inches = 60/12 = 5 feet

Therefore, the number of feet that she sews in a minute is

5/60 = 0.083 feet per minute

She sews 0.083 feet per minute.
